BOONE, N.C. – The Mars Hill men's track and field team placed 12th out of 13 teams Saturday afternoon at the Holmes Convocation Center. The Lions picked up 12 points overall.
Freshman Nicholas Izquierdo earned two points with a with a seventh place finish in the 300 meter dash, turning in a time of 38.19. Earning eight points in the 3000 meter run, Noah Allison placed second with a time of 9:05.63. He finished first out of all Division II competitors.
In the triple jump, Bryan Smith earned two points with a seventh place finish. He recorded a mark of 12.10m (39'8.50").
